How AI Art is Democratizing the Art World
In the 50 years since its invention, artificial intelligence (AI) has made great strides. The concept has evolved into a practical tool used in a wide range of industries, including healthcare, finance, and transportation.
In today’s world, artificial intelligence is being used in a variety of ways to help with various tasks and processes. To diagnose and treat patients, doctors can use AI to analyze medical images, such as X-rays and MRIs. AI can be used to analyze market trends and make investment recommendations in finance. The use of artificial intelligence in transportation can optimize routes for delivery trucks or assist autonomous vehicles.
The advantages of AI as a tool are numerous. It can work around the clock without getting tired or needing breaks, and it can be faster and more accurate than humans at certain tasks. Additionally, it can be programmed to perform a wide range of tasks, making it highly versatile and adaptable.
AI, however, is not just a tool for practical purposes. As well as being used by artists, it is also being used by designers to create and enhance their work. AI can be used to create images, music, and even short films in the digital arts. Machine learning algorithms are being used by some artists to create unique paintings and sculptures using AI.
